Transaction

63685218adaab8d15cdcc02039ccf0a24c8a373dce6e06c3ec8e5c08e7a39665
458,901 confirmations
Timestamp
1501850913
Block479,008
Fee30,318 sats
Fee rate134.2 sats/vB
view on mempool.space

Inputs & Outputs